Dhara Dhevi Chiang Mai, Thailand

Despite the fact that a stay at the Dhara Dhevi Chiang Mai is nothing short of magnificent, the resort provides an authentic Thai atmosphere with suites and villas surrounded by rice fields. Dheva Spa is a Thai spa with Burmese and Shan influences that offers a wide range of therapies. There is something for everyone, whether you desire a traditional massage, an Ayurvedic treatment, or a spiritual experience. At this lovely spa resort in Thailand, Ayurvedic treatments dating back over 5,000 years allow you to achieve a balance of mind and body in a quiet setting. Enjoy a dosha analysis with a local Ayurvedic specialist who will walk you through a customised treatment plan. Sign up for the "Indian Ceremony," a half-day program that includes a welcoming foot bath, Ubtan scrub, Shirobhyanga and Abhyanga Massages with warm Ayurvedic oils, Ubtan wrap, and a herbal steam. Another excellent option is the "Royal Thai" Ceremony, which mixes a variety of natural elements to help you relax and de-stress. A welcoming foot ritual, Safflower scrub, steam with jasmine body masque, Thai flowery jasmine bath, Royal Thai massage, and face acupressure massage are all part of the ceremony.

 

Huvafen Fushi, Maldives

Seasoned spa goers understand that an underwater spa is a rarity due to the high construction expenses, yet the experience is unlike any other. Watch beautiful tropical fish swim past you as you receive peaceful massages and other treatments at this one-of-a-kind resort in the Maldives' Huvafen Fushi. Lime Spa merges cutting edge architecture with soothing treatments in a stunning underwater setting. The spa is a free-standing complex with overwater treatment rooms with spectacular views out to the horizon, as well as underwater treatment rooms with huge glass windows facing the fish. The underwater treatment rooms are eerily similar to scenes from a James Bond film. The underwater rooms are designed with airy materials inspired by sea kelp. The surrounding coral and sponges are imitated by soft cushions. Immerse yourself in this one-of-a-kind experience by trying one of the hallmark therapies, such as LIME Light - Crystal Ritual and Turquoise Explosion.

El Silencio Lodge & Spa, Costa Rica

Embedded in Costa Rica’s Central Volcanic Valley and flanked by Juan Castro Blanco and Poas Volcano National Parks, El Silencio Lodge & Spa is an eco-friendly retreat surrounded by the swirling mists of a private cloud forest reserve, teeming with birds and wildlife. The spa was created in conjunction with nature, and it includes a one-of-a-kind area designed to channel the vital energy of the forest. Beautifully built timber cabins have luxurious amenities and are comfortably decorated with contemporary décor. High ceilings and big bay windows offer a magnificent sense of space and encourage the views in, resulting in a sumptuous cocoon surrounded by nature. Savor an exotic menu of Costa Rican cuisine conjured with an array of delicious regional ingredients, accompanied by a selection of world-class vintages. Located in an area that is famous for its incredible landscape, the lodge gives guests access to exciting activities and outdoor adventures - take exhilarating canopy tours in the dense rainforest or go on a horseback tour to see the volcano. Rooms start at $206 per night.

 

Gili Lankanfushi in the Maldives

Gili Lankanfushi is a vacation idea for anyone who is looking for a place where the architecture is anything but ordinary. Meera Spa is situated on stilts over the turquoise lagoon and allows you to literally escape from the stresses of everyday life. Guests are housed in over-water bungalows connected to the island by three piers, some of which are only accessible by boat. Roof sundecks, floating sundeck, and open-air private bathrooms with plush tubs make it easy to continue relaxing after your visit to the spa. Villas start at $1,328 per night.
